1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What do we call the highest or lowest point of a quadratic?

Back

Vertex

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the standard form of a quadratic function?

Back

y = ax² + bx + c

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the axis of symmetry for the quadratic function y = 3x² - 6x + 4?

Back

x = 1

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the vertex of the function f(x) = -x² - 4x + 12?

Back

(-2, 16)

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the vertex of the parabola y = -2x² - 4x + 1?

Back

(-1, 3)

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What does the 'a' in the standard form of a quadratic function y = ax² + bx + c represent?

Back

The coefficient that determines the direction and width of the parabola.

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the significance of the 'b' in the standard form of a quadratic function?

Back

It affects the position of the vertex along the x-axis.
